A Hacker 2.28M Facebook IDSCimpanuZdNet has leaked the personal details of 2.28 million users of MeetMindful, a dating site. The data includes real names, email addresses, Facebook account tokens, geo-location information and other sensitive information. The file, which is 1.2 gigabytes in size, was release on a publicly accessible hacking forum. It also contains IP addresses, Bcrypt-hash passwords and Facebook authentication tokens that can be used to access users’ accounts.
The Hacker 2.28M Facebook IDSCimpanuZdNet is being blam on ShinyHunters, a hacking group that has been responsible for many high-profile data breaches. It has also been credit with the theft of user records from Teespring and Bonobo, two e-commerce sites that allow users to create custom printed clothing. If you have signed up for a MeetMindful account before March 2020, the company has warn you that your data may have been compromise.

Confidential Business Data
To protect your confidential business data, restrict access to employees and others who have a legitimate need to know the information. It is also a good idea to review access lists regularly and revoke them when necessary. File encryption is a great way to make sensitive files unreadable to anyone except those who have the right passwords or keys. This can be especially helpful if you store information on smaller storage devices like USB drives that are easily lost or misplace. It is also a good idea to set strict policies about sharing confidential information, and keep it locked in a safe at all times.
